Boiled Pigeons
4 servings
Ingredients
- 4 pcs pigeons
- water (a little)
- 1 tsp salt
- 3 pcs peppercorns
- 0.5 pcs bay leaf
- 1 pcs carrot
- 1 pcs parsley root
- butter (a little)
- rice (as needed)
Instructions
- Place 4 prepared pigeons in enough boiling water to just cover them.
- Add 1 teaspoon of salt, 3 peppercorns, ½ bay leaf, 1 carrot, 1 parsley root, and a piece of butter.
- Cook slowly until tender for ¾ – 1 hour.
- Serve with fricassee sauce or fine vegetables.
- For invalids, serve with the broth, prepared without spices.
- You can also let rice swell thickly in the broth and serve it with the pigeon.
Modernized from a treasured 19th-century German cookbook.
